1 i.MX CPUFreq-DT OPP bindings
2 ================================
3
4 Certain i.MX SoCs support different OPPs depending on the "market segment" and
5 "speed grading" value which are written in fuses. These bits are combined with
6 the opp-supported-hw values for each OPP to check if the OPP is allowed.
7
8 Required properties:
9 --------------------
10
11 For each opp entry in 'operating-points-v2' table:
12 - opp-supported-hw: Two bitmaps indicating:
13   - Supported speed grade mask
14   - Supported market segment mask
15     0: Consumer
16     1: Extended Consumer
17     2: Industrial
18     3: Automotive
19
20 Example:
21 --------
22
23 opp_table {
24         compatible = "operating-points-v2";
25         opp-1000000000 {
26                 opp-hz = /bits/ 64 <1000000000>;
27                 /* grade >= 0, consumer only */
28                 opp-supported-hw = <0xf>, <0x3>;
29         };
30
31         opp-1300000000 {
32                 opp-hz = /bits/ 64 <1300000000>;
33                 opp-microvolt = <1000000>;
34                 /* grade >= 1, all segments */
35                 opp-supported-hw = <0xe>, <0x7>;
36         };
37 }
